China High Quality Self Adhesive Felt Roll White China High Quality Wool Felt Roll Bonded Felt Home Depot
How to Use China High Quality Self Adhesive Felt Roll White for Home Decor Projects Self adhesive felt rolls are a great way to add a touch of style and texture to any home decor project. With their high quality and easy to use design, these rolls are perfect for a variety of projects. Here…